Understanding Base64 Encoding and Decoding
Base64 embodies a basic process for transforming binary data into a string of printable ASCII characters. This format is commonly used when sending data over mediums, like email or URLs, that restrict the use of certain glyphs. Essentially, it operates by grouping binary data into blocks and then substituting each block with a corresponding set of Base64 letters . Decoding the process entails performing the opposite operation: taking the Base64 transformed string and converting it back into its original binary structure.
- This can be achieved using various tools .
- It’s crucial to remember that Base64 is never a form of encryption ; it’s merely an encoding .
